#3dc537 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3dc537 is composed of 23.9% red, 77.3%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.1%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 117.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 49.4%. #3dc537 color hex could be obtained by blending #7aff6e with #008b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#3dc537 color description : Moderate lime green.
#3dc537 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3dc537 has RGB values of R:61, G:197,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 4048183.
